Chelsea Hit with FA Fine and Transfer Restrictions Over Agent Rule Breaches

Chelsea Football Club has been subjected to further penalties for contravening financial regulations. The club has incurred a substantial fine from the Football Association (FA) and has been handed transfer restrictions as a consequence of violating rules pertaining to player agents.

These sanctions stem from identified breaches in the club's dealings with football agents. The specific details of the violations have not been fully disclosed by the FA, but the outcome signifies a stringent approach to enforcing financial fair play and agent conduct rules within the sport.

The financial penalty imposed on Chelsea is a direct consequence of their non-compliance. In addition to the fine, the transfer restrictions will significantly impact the club's ability to acquire new players in upcoming transfer windows. The exact nature and duration of these restrictions are yet to be clarified, but they are expected to curtail Chelsea's spending power and limit their options in the player market.

This latest disciplinary action adds to a series of financial and regulatory challenges Chelsea has faced recently. The club's management will now need to focus on addressing these sanctions and ensuring strict adherence to all financial and agent-related regulations moving forward to avoid further repercussions.

The ramifications of these sanctions extend beyond immediate financial costs, potentially affecting Chelsea's long-term squad development and competitive standing.
